DUI Statistics in Standard, IL
Driving Under the Influence (DUI) remains a critical issue in Standard, IL, and the surrounding counties. The Department of Transportation (DOT) has been actively engaged in efforts to curb the incidence of DUI-related accidents. In Illinois, DUI is defined as operating a vehicle with a blood alcohol concentration (BAC) of 0.08% or more. Recent data show that there has been a decrease in DUI cases over the past few years in Putnam County, where Standard is located, thanks to increased law enforcement and public awareness campaigns. However, challenges remain as first-time offenders and repeat offenders continue to contribute to DUI statistics in the area, necessitating ongoing intervention by state and local authorities.

Marijuana-Related Accidents in Standard, IL
Following the legalization of recreational marijuana in Illinois, the potential impact on marijuana-related vehicular accidents has become a focal point for authorities in Standard, IL. The Illinois Department of Transportation (IDOT), along with local agencies in Putnam County, are closely monitoring the situation. There is concern about drivers operating vehicles under the influence of THC, the active component of marijuana, which can impair reaction times and judgment. While there is ongoing debate about the extent of impact, preliminary studies suggest a slight increase in traffic incidents associated with marijuana use post-legalization. Efforts are being made to better understand the trends and implement policies that ensure road safety.
